Knowledge Regarding Prevention of Complications of Diabetes Mellitus

Guramrit Kaur | Ishak Mohammad | Davinder Kaur [3]


Abstract: The objective of the study was to evaluate the effectiveness of Individualized Planned Teaching Programme (IPTP) on knowledge regarding prevention of complications of Diabetes Mellitus among Diabetic patients. A quasi experimental study conducted in selected IPDs of Gian Sagar Hospital. Fifty diabetic patients were chosen by purposive sampling technique. Self reported structured knowledge questionnaire was used to assess the knowledge of the diabetic patients. Reliability of the tool was calculated by split half method. Tool was found reliable (r=0.82). The findings revealed that the mean post-test knowledge scores of Experimental group & control group was 31.12 1.590 & 21.32 1.952 respectively with Mean difference of 9.80 & also findings were found statistically significant (p0.05). According to the result of this study, IPTP has a favorable impact on knowledge regarding prevention of complications of Diabetes Mellitus among Diabetic patients.
